Things to do in and around Nasushiobara

Nasushiobara, located in Tochigi Prefecture, Japan, is perfect for adventure seekers and families alike. Visitors can enjoy skiing at local ski fields, explore numerous hiking trails, and take in the stunning views of picturesque waterfalls. With its blend of outdoor activities and attractions like amusement parks, Nasushiobara promises an exciting vacation experience for everyone.

Shopping

Visit Meiji no Mori/Kuroiso Road Station for unique local goods in Nasushiobara. Enjoy shopping at Nasu Garden Outlet, a vibrant center with a mix of shops and family-friendly vibes. If you're up for a drive, Nasu Kogen Yuai no Mori Road Station is located 11.3km away, offering more shopping options.

Recreation

Explore Karasugamori Park for serene walks among nature, perfect for relaxation. At Nasunogahara Park Observation Tower, enjoy panoramic views and peaceful surroundings. Venture to Nasu Heisei-no-mori Forest, located 16.1km away, for tranquil hikes and rejuvenating forest therapy amidst lush greenery.

Adventure

Hunter Mountain Shiobara, located 14.5km from Nasushiobara, offers thrilling skiing experiences with stunning mountain views. Similarly, Edelweiss Ski Resort, also 14.5km away, boasts excellent slopes for skiing enthusiasts. For those seeking more, Mt. Jeans Ski Resort, 17.7km from Nasushiobara, provides an exhilarating atmosphere for winter sports lovers.

Nightlife

Experience the vibrant nightlife in Nasushiobara by visiting Nasu Keiryu Park for thrilling arcade games and adventure vibes. For a cultural outing, enjoy a show at Nikko Saru Gundan theater, or have fun at Big Maze Palladium, another exciting arcade adventure zone that promises a night of entertainment.

Best time to go to Nasushiobara

The best time to visit Nasushiobara can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Nasushiobara fal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Nasushiobara fal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January29.5°F (-1.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February30.6°F (-0.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March38.3°F (3.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April47.7°F (8.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.8°F (18.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July72.1°F (22.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August73.8°F (23.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September66.2°F (19.0°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October55.0°F (12.8°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
December35.1°F (1.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Nasushiobara

Traveling to Nasushiobara is convenient with nearby airports such as Ibaraki (IBR) and Fukushima (FKS). Ibaraki Airport is approximately 101.4km from Nasushiobara, with nearby hotel options like the 3.5-star Mito Plaza Hotel and Plaza, both located 19.3km away, and the 3-star Hotel Route Inn Ishioka, just 11.3km from the airport. Fukushima Airport is closer, at about 53.1km, offering accommodations like the 3.5-star Hotel Wing International Sukagawa, 8.0km away, Kanazawa Sky Hotel, 9.7km away, and the Koriyama View Hotel Annex, 19.3km from the airport. These hotels provide a comfortable stay while exploring the region.

What should I see while I'm in Nasushiobara?

Cultural venues include Nasunogahara Museum and Healing Museum. Landmarks like Momijidani Suspension Bridge, Nasunogahara Park Observation Tower, and Myounji Temple might be worth a visit. Natural beauty is on display at Nikko National Park, Mikaeri Waterfall, and Otome Waterfall. Check out what more to see and do in Expedia's Nasushiobara guide.

How should I get around Nasushiobara?

If you'd like to explore more of the area, hop aboard a train from Nasushiobara Station, Kuroiso Station, or Nishi-Nasuno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Nasushiobara for your journey.

What's the seasonal weather like in Nasushiobara?

The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 69°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 33°F. The rainiest months in Nasushiobara are July, September, August, and June, with each month seeing an average of 10 inches of rainfall.
